Summary
Petra Gehring is a human[1]. Her place of birth was Düsseldorf[2]. She was born on +1961-10-08T00:00:00Z[3]. She worked as a university teacher[4] and philosopher[5].

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include university teacher[4] and philosopher[5]. Fields of work include metaphysics[7], a branch of philosophy[27]; phenomenology[8], a philosophical movement[28]; structuralism[9], a theory[29]; Post-structuralism[10], a philosophical movement[30]; philosophy of law[11], a branch of philosophy[31]; and aesthetics[12], a branch of philosophy[32]. Employers include Technical University of Darmstadt[13], a public university[33], in Germany[34], founded in 1877[35] and Ruhr University Bochum[14], a public university[36], in Germany[37], founded in 1962[38], headquartered in Bochum[39].
